Conference: Adorno-Heidegger: Art, Ecology, Politics

Oct 21, 2022 - Oct 22, 2022
RSVP
  • + Google Calendar
  • + iCal Export
  • + Outlook Export
Share
view of lexington ave going uptown with the facade of Thomas Hunter

A conference honoring Professor Joan Stambaugh,
Department of Philosophy, Hunter College, CUNY
with support from the German Department
and the Office of the President, Hunter College


Wind und Wolken, Gabriel Münter, 1910

Adorno-Heidegger: Art, Ecology, Politics will reflect on the 20th-century contributions of Theodor
Adorno and Martin Heidegger from a 21st-century lens. With our present perspectives evolving to
include previously marginalized thinkers and themes, this conference will further the historical
reconstruction of 20th-century philosophy by examining the central roles Heidegger and Adorno
played within it, with particular attention to the two figures' clash over aesthetic, environmental and
political transformations. The conference will also celebrate the crucial role women play in the
Hunter College Philosophy Department, promoting gender balance in the discipline.

Featured Speakers:

  • J.M. Bernstein (New School)
  • Maeve Cook (University College Dublin)
  • Peter Gordon (Harvard)
  • Tom Huhn (School of Visual Arts)
  • Max Pensky (SUNY-Binghamton)
  • Taylor Carman (Barnard)
  • Samir Gandesha (Simon Fraser)
  • Peter Uwe Hohendahl (Cornell)
  • Iain Macdonald (Montreal)
  • Liliane Weissberg (University of Pennsylvania)
